Yardi Matrix Documents Rent Collection’s Impact on U.S. Affordable Housing

Rent Collection’s Impact on US Affordable Housing

Local policies becoming a larger component of the market’s operating environment

SANTA BARBARA, Calif., July 22, 2026 – New Yardi® Matrix analysis documents the impact of rent collection success on key aspects of U.S. housing providers’ operating performance. 

While affordable housing programs establish the framework for scheduled revenue, local operating environments increasingly determine how much of that revenue is realized, a new Yardi Matrix national report reveals.

“Markets participating in similar federal programs … produce different financial outcomes because the regulations governing delinquent rent differ across jurisdictions” due to factors ranging from pandemic-era eviction bans to the judicial system’s responsiveness, the report says.


“Affordability pressures are already elevated, and higher energy costs … erode discretionary income and disproportionately impact lower-income households, further limiting renters’ ability to absorb rising housing costs,” states a new national report from Yardi Matrix.

“Understanding local collection environments becomes an increasingly important component of market analysis,” the report states, because realized revenue determines housing providers’ cash flow, reserve funding, capital planning and long-term asset preservation.

The percentage of realized revenue in May 2026 ranged from 96.8% in Miami to 70.9% in Washington, D.C., with the typical large market collecting 88.6% of scheduled rent. The D.C. government, recognizing that “prolonged rent delinquency had become a threat not only to individual owners but to the long-term preservation and production of affordable housing,” as stated in the Yardi Matrix report, recently enacted legislation that streamlines portions of the nonpayment process.
